Transaction 7a951516437d9e634ec41f9624d629546bc3ee1304ca1026c66ad0debf29c83a
1 Input
1 Output
-
7a951516437d9e634ec41f9624d629546bc3ee1304ca1026c66ad0debf29c83a:0
- value
- 1462825
- script pubkey
- OP_0 OP_PUSHBYTES_20 80a3c2f1c76c34baf2465e182151bc5982b0ffda
- address
- bc1qsz3u9uw8ds6t4ujxtcvzz5dutxptpl7620de8m